TGCarbon integrates proven biomass conversion technologies with industrial-scale project development to produce low-carbon fuels and renewable chemicals. Our platform is designed to maximize carbon utilization, support multiple feedstocks, and enable scalable commercial deployment.
Biomass gasification is the foundation of our platform. Sustainably sourced biomass is converted into a clean synthesis gas (syngas), creating a flexible building block for renewable fuel production.
